FAQ
How to search with EDNAME
Do I have to enter the required letters from left to right?
No.
You decide exactly
where each fixed
letter appears.
Empty positions may be
at the beginning,
in the middle,
or at the end.
__CHECK
CHECK__
C_EC_K
Each underscore represents
a position EDNAME can
replace with A–Z.
What is a good search strategy?
Start with a word,
abbreviation,
or fragment that matters
to you.
Then leave a small number
of positions empty.
__CHECK
CHECK__
CHECK___
This is usually much faster
and produces more useful
results than leaving many
unrelated positions empty.
Can I enter more than the minimum?
Yes.
The displayed requirement
is only the minimum.
You may fill additional
positions or complete
the entire word.
If every field is filled,
EDNAME checks exactly
one name against the
selected domain extensions.
What do I pay for?
The search itself
and the information about
how many available domains
were found are free.
You pay only if you want
to download the TXT file
containing the actual
domain names.
Reports containing
1–50 available domains
cost $2.00.
Each additional
available domain
adds $0.01.
What are the extension search modes?
One extension
searches one extension selected from the live catalog.
Custom extensions lets you enter several extensions yourself.
All open extensions searches every classified single-level extension that is generally available to ordinary registrants.
All extensions + requirements searches every classified single-level extension, including those with residency, professional, institutional or other eligibility requirements.
All regional extensions searches country-code extensions plus supported city, region and cultural extensions.
EDNAME intentionally excludes multi-level provider entries such as .com.pl or .co.uk. Only one-part extensions after the domain name are used.
